Output e5585aa73bb97ef1ed8a2f04c80b08da63e593393f726aa344f0b79b85c6b902:0

value
3699437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534df27f959ebecf6edc78705a8d01d96b37b6c2 OP_EQUAL
address
39HVPLTENRNuJTrRavDwwmDPa8JBjzxxsY
transaction
e5585aa73bb97ef1ed8a2f04c80b08da63e593393f726aa344f0b79b85c6b902
confirmations
299398
spent
true